OUR VISION We are a Local Church, with an eye for the Nations for the supreme worth of Jesus Christ. God has placed us in King George County to live and serve. Through hospitality we want to reach our community for multi-generational, multiethnic worship of the one, true God. We believe in the joy of God s sovereignty, believer s baptism, and serving others by following Jesus example of love, sacrifice, and compassion. God has a kingdom that will include every nation, tribe, people, and language. Our hearts desire is for unengaged people groups to know the joy of Jesus. We want to do our part as goers and senders to fulfill the Great Commission in our community and to the ends of the earth. God has revealed himself through Jesus Christ. We treasure Jesus as the focus, admiration, and joy of life. He is our only hope for salvation. We are created to worship and enjoy Jesus. All that Redeemer Church is and does is based on the supremacy of Jesus in all things; every ministry, service, and outreach is centered on knowing Jesus fully and worshipping him alone. 1

Through the local church, people hear this great message about fullness of joy in Jesus Christ. In a county of 25,000 residents, King George has approximately 30 churches with an estimated 9,000 members. This leaves more than 16,000 people who are searching aimlessly for joy and purpose in this life. ~ KING GEORGE COUNTY NEEDS MORE CHURCHES TO PROCLAIM THE TRUTH OF THE GLORY OF JESUS CHRIST AND REACH PEOPLE FOR THEIR JOY. ~ Our neighbors are in a perilous state before God and need to know the forgiveness and repentance given through Christ. The great work of the gospel has been spreading in our community, but more people need to hear this good news. We are planting in King George County so more will hear about the supreme worth of Jesus Christ and experience the eternal joy of his grace. 4

OUR LEADERSHIP JIM REGER Jim was called to ministry in 2012 and entered seminary at Liberty Baptist Theological Seminary. At the time, Jim and his wife were invited to be International Mission Board of the Southern Baptist Convention missionary candidates while simultaneously Jim was asked to fill the youth pastor position at their church. The Lord led him to pastor the youth and build awareness and passion for serving him here and abroad. Jim stepped down as youth minister in Fall 2014 to complete seminary and pursue missions full-time. He then had the incredible opportunity to train pastors overseas as part of theological famine relief. Churches in the Majority World are battling false beliefs outside and inside the church, just as we are here. Despite the obstacles, our brothers overseas boldly proclaim Christ in difficult situations. Jim wants to spread the same passion in King George County for treasuring Jesus Christ and proclaiming him as the focus, admiration, and joy of life. Jim graduated from LBTS in May 2016 with a Masters of Divinity degree. He served in the US Marine Reserves, with a tour in Iraq, and was a corporate executive for 14 years. He has been married to his wife, Christian, since 2000, and they have 5 children. 10
